Output 31ccd3a690bbadb54a00c4b743fe2a51ac8713e3b2c804d7ba0784a24d0a62db:1

value
17014652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e42da0698c50b0cb190c13783435316d25800199 OP_EQUALVERIFY OP_CHECKSIG
address
1MoVivvtfUvy1ghuPLsBGtnXP9jkvWbzNn
transaction
31ccd3a690bbadb54a00c4b743fe2a51ac8713e3b2c804d7ba0784a24d0a62db
confirmations
303834
spent
true